Neuromorphic Sensing & Computing Market Overview

The Neuromorphic Sensing & Computing Market is forecast to reach $560.4 million by 2027, growing at a CAGR of 84.2% from 2022 to 2027. Future autonomous AI systems that demand energy efficiency and continual learning will be powered by neuromorphic computing's novel architectural approach. It has already been used in a variety of domains, including sensing, robotics, healthcare, and large-scale AI applications, and promises to open up intriguing new possibilities in computing. In neuromorphic computing, spiking neural networks (SNNs) are used to make choices in response to learnt patterns over time. SNNs are innovative models that imitate natural learning by dynamically re-mapping neural networks. These asynchronous, event-based SNNs are used in neuromorphic computers to deliver orders of magnitude power and performance advantages over traditional designs. The industry is growing as traditional chip processing power growth slows and demand for AI-based applications rises. The major players in the global Neuromorphic Sensing & Computing Market are heavily investing in neuromorphic chips in order to provide improved processing capabilities while consuming less power. The falling processing capacity of chipsets, rising demand for nonvolatile memory, shifting semiconductor paradigm, and increased demand for applications driven by new technologies such as artificial intelligence, machine learning, and others are some of the primary factors driving the market expansion of neuromorphic sensing & computing. Hence, these factors will drive Neuromorphic Sensing & Computing Market size in the forecast period 2022-2027.

Neuromorphic Sensing & Computing Market Segment Analysis- By End user

This market is segmented into Automotive, Aerospace and Defense, IT and Telecom, Industrial, Healthcare, Others, on the basis of End user. Aerospace and Defense is anticipated to witness significant amount of growth with CAGR of 38% during the forecast period 2022-2027. Today's aerospace and defense industries are dealing with an exponential growth of data from a range of sensors. The little bandwidth available for military usage has been severely stressed by unprecedented data collecting. Before further transmission, the data must be processed as near to the sensor as feasible. As a result, sequential computing algorithms are inefficient in this aspect due to their huge size and power needs. This parallel task can be carried out significantly more effectively with NeuroSynaptic devices. Neuromorphic computing has the ability to process data quicker than any other processor, which aids the aerospace and military industries in processing sensitive data such as combat data, including weaponry and resource management. Another reason driving the growth of the neuromorphic computing market for the aerospace and military industry is the growing need for testing and transferring signals to securely code and transmit data from one end to another to lessen the possibility of security concerns.

Neuromorphic Sensing & Computing Market Drivers

Rise in demand for improved Integrated circuits (ICs) tends to drive the market growth for Neuromorphic Sensing & Computing:

As data and program instructions are stored in a block of memory that is distinct from the processor which executes the instructions, the central processing unit (CPU) must continually shuttle information back and forth from the memory store. As a result, data transit consumes a lot of power and slows down the processor's optimal performance, lowering the total processing speed. Neuromorphic chips, on the other hand, can process data in parallel and store data on the device. Data shuttling is avoided when processing and storage are combined, allowing for more efficient computing. During the projection period, the need for higher-performance ICs will thus be a major driving force in the Neuromorphic Sensing & Computing Market. Neuromorphic Sensing & Computing Market Challenges

The development of real-world applications is being slowed by a lack of R&D and investments which act as hindrance to the market growth for Neuromorphic Sensing & Computing:

Complex algorithms increase the difficulty of developing hardware for neuromorphic chips, and lack of information about neuromorphic computing are some of the primary problems limiting the growth of the neuromorphic computing business. Furthermore, defining the algorithms, that is, the structure and dynamics of the network, is one of the most significant current issues in neuromorphic computing, which is impeding market growth throughout the forecast period 2022-2027.

Recent Developments

  • In May 2021, CEA-Leti unveiled an EU initiative to create analogue spiking processors that replicate biological brain networks by developing algorithms, electronic devices, and circuits. The initiative started in 2020 with a group of academics from Leti, IMEC, IBM Zurich, and the China-backed Swiss firm SynSense AG.
  • In March 2020, Intel has announced the availability of Pohoiki Springs, the company's newest and most powerful neuromorphic research facility. This system has a compute capacity of 100 million neurons and is 1,000 times quicker and 10,000 times more efficient than traditional processors.
